Rocket GPS Art Running Route in London — 14.4 km

A 14.4 km loop through London that draws a rocket when you upload it to Strava. The line follows public streets and paths and covers a footprint about 2.2 km wide by 3.8 km tall.

How to run this shape

  1. Download the GPX file with your subscription and load it onto your watch, or open it in the ShapeMiles app.
  2. Start anywhere on the loop — beginning near a landmark makes the finish easier to find.
  3. Keep GPS recording continuous. Pausing mid-run leaves straight lines that cut across the drawing.
  4. Follow the corners precisely; short detours are what blur the shape.
  5. Upload to Strava and the rocket appears on your activity map.
